我不知道为什么会这样做,当我试图修剪它时会吐出一个错误.
>>> print os.system('uptime')
21:05 up 9:40, 2 users, load averages: 0.69 0.76 0.82
0
>>> print os.system('uptime')[:-2]
21:07 up 9:42, 2 users, load averages: 0.75 0.74 0.80
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
TypeError: 'int' object is not subscriptable
Run Code Online (Sandbox Code Playgroud)
有谁知道如何阻止这种情况发生或如何在没有错误的情况下将其删除?谢谢!
我想使用GROUP BY而不删除重复项.我的表看起来像这样:
+----+-----+-----+
|user|guess|score|
+----+-----+-----+
|abc |12345|5 |
|def |67890|8 |
|ghi |11121|5 |
|jkl |31415|13 |
|mno |16171|4 |
|pqr |81920|13 |
+----+-----+-----+
Run Code Online (Sandbox Code Playgroud)
每当我这样做SELECT user, score FROM guesses GROUP BY score,我得到这个:
+----+-----+
|user|score|
+----+-----+
|mno |4 |
|abc |5 |
|def |8 |
|jkl |13 |
+----+-----+
Run Code Online (Sandbox Code Playgroud)
我想要这个(下面),其中重复项按字母顺序排列.
+----+-----+
|user|score|
+----+-----+
|mno |4 |
|abc |5 |
|ghi |5 |
|def |8 |
|jkl |13 |
|pqr |13 |
+----+-----+
Run Code Online (Sandbox Code Playgroud)
我正在做一个高分系统猜测,但如果它删除了重复,那将是不公平的.
你认为它可能与PHP解析它的方式有关吗?我正在使用phpMyAdmin,所以应该显示正确的输出...